Fuel Type Options
Selecting the right fuel type for your smoker grill combo can substantially impact your cooking experience and the flavors you achieve. Charcoal delivers a rich, smoky flavor and high heat but requires more effort to ignite and maintain temperature. Gas models start quickly, offer precise temperature control, and are highly convenient, making them perfect for beginners. Wood pellet smokers provide consistent heat and a deep, smoky taste with digital controls, which simplifies operation. Some hybrid models let you switch between fuel types or combine them, offering greater flexibility for different recipes and outdoor cooking styles. When choosing, consider how much effort you want to invest and the flavor profile you prefer. Your choice of fuel will shape your overall grilling experience and the variety of dishes you can create.
Cooking Capacity Needs
Understanding your cooking capacity needs is essential to picking the right smoker grill combo. Think about how many people you usually cook for—if you host large gatherings, look for models with at least 750 square inches of cooking surface. Consider whether you need extra smoking or warming areas, which can add hundreds of square inches for versatile cooking. Decide if you prefer separate chambers for smoking and grilling or an integrated design that maximizes space in a compact unit. If you often smoke multiple large cuts of meat at once, choose a smoker with at least 272 square inches of offset space or extra racks. Also, opt for models with adjustable racks and removable shelves to optimize space for different foods and sizes.

Maintenance and Cleanup
Keeping your smoker grill combo easy to clean and maintain makes a big difference, especially for beginners. Look for models with removable ash pans or trays—they make cleanup quick and effortless. Built-in thermometer guides help you monitor internal temperatures without opening the lid, reducing mess and heat loss. Easy-access doors for adding charcoal or wood chips, and removing ashes, minimize spills and disruptions. Choose grills with durable, high-temperature enamel coatings on the cooking surfaces, which prevent residue buildup and simplify cleaning. Additionally, models with foldable or retractable components like side shelves or racks make thorough cleaning easier. Prioritizing these features ensures maintenance doesn’t become a chore, so you can focus on perfecting your smoky dishes without hassle.
